Alone with Jesus

Author: Mary Ingalls Pierce Hymnal: Gloria Deo #122 (1901) First Line: Alone with Jesus! blessed place Lyrics: 1 Alone with Jesus! blessed place, Where I behold Him face to face, And every line of beauty trace,— Companionship divine. 2 Alone with Jesus, while without Are care and danger, fear and doubt; But while with Him, the world shut out, The joys of heav’n are mine. 3 Alone with Jesus, oh, the bliss Of holding converse such as this; All anxious care I now dismiss, And all of earth resign. 4 Alone with Jesus, oh, how blest! Close folded to my Saviour’s breast, Be Thou, dear Lord, my constant guest, And keep me wholly Thine. Topics: Christ Communion with Languages: English Tune Title: INGLASS
